Can GeForce RTX 4060 run Blackout Memphis?

Great

The GeForce RTX 4060 handles Blackout Memphis well at 1080p, delivering approximately 324 FPS at High settings — above the 60 FPS target for smooth gameplay. It can also achieve smooth 1440p at around 243 FPS.

Blackout MemphisGeForce RTX 4060 FPS Data

Quality1080p1440p4K
Low506 fps380 fps202 fps
Medium405 fps304 fps162 fps
High324 fps243 fps130 fps
Ultra263 fps197 fps105 fps

Estimated FPS · actual performance may vary based on drivers and settings

About

Blackout Memphis, released in 2024, is an intense top-down shooter that immerses players in chaotic gunfights and brutal melee combat. Its fast-paced gameplay features blood-soaked action, enhanced by an electrifying soundtrack that deepens the gritty atmosphere. As part of the indie genre, it stands out for its unique style and thrilling moments that keep players on the edge of their seats.

In terms of PC performance, Blackout Memphis is fairly accessible, falling in line with entry-level hardware requirements. To achieve a smooth gaming experience, players should aim for a minimum GPU score of around 4823, which corresponds to lower-tier graphics cards. With at least 6 GB of RAM, users can expect decent FPS even at higher settings, making it an enjoyable title for budget-conscious gamers while still delivering engaging visuals and fast action.
